Beccy Blake

Beccy Blake has worked on a variety of children’s books as an author, illustrator and storyboard artist. Her work spans picture books, educational reading schemes and comics. Her practice also includes character design and illustration for animation.

Blake’s illustration credits include titles in major UK reading programmes such as Read Write Inc. Phonics, Collins Big Cat and Reading Champion. Her work appears across decodable readers and early fiction, with a focus on clear visual storytelling for developing readers. Publishers listing her work include Hachette Children’s Group, among others. In graphic fiction, Bloomsbury Children’s acquired her middle-grade series Chicken Hill and is represented by Bath Literary Agency.

Books she has authored and illustrated are The Chicken Hill Series, humorous, action-packed graphic novels about a strange town full of bizarre adventures, aimed at older children. Early readers and educational books she worked on are Collins Big Cat series, My Exercise Diary and What Am I?, simple, early reading books designed for young children learning to read. Books she illustrated include the Reading Champion series and Dragon’s Lost Roar.

Since leaving art college in Newcastle upon Tyne she has worked extensively in the world of children’s publishing, animation, design and advertising, editorial, greetings cards and bespoke mural and art commissions, both here in the UK and overseas. She works mainly in pencil, acrylics, watercolour, pen and ink and digital media often combining all.

As well as regular illustration commissions she has been working with Complete Control, a double Bafta winning children’s digital multimedia Studio, based in Bath, on the first, second and third series of Nick Cope’s Popcast for CBeebies. Beccy Blake’s involvement in the animation department is 
a testament to the collaborative effort that goes into creating the beloved children’s show.
